Skip to Content
Build REST APIs with Django REST Framework and Python
on-demand course

Build REST APIs with Django REST Framework and Python

with Shubham Sarda
June 2021
Advanced
12h 55m
English
Packt Publishing
Closed Captioning available in English, Spanish

Overview

In this 12-hour course, you will master the process of building robust and scalable REST APIs using Django REST Framework, complemented by Python's versatility. By creating an IMDB API clone, you'll dive deep into vital concepts like authentication, throttling, and testing.

What I will be able to do after this course

  • Understand REST API concepts from the ground up.
  • Master authorization practices including JWT tokens and role-based access.
  • Build and test APIs efficiently using tools like Postman and automated testing.
  • Incorporate advanced functionality such as throttling, pagination, filtering, and search.
  • Apply theoretical knowledge to practical projects, ensuring real-world readiness.

Course Instructor(s)

Shubham Sarda is an experienced educator and developer with a rich background in Python and Django. Shubham specializes in simplifying complex technical concepts for beginners and provides a hands-on learning experience. His approachable teaching style ensures that even novices can confidently step into the world of API development.

Who is it for?

Ideal for Django developers eager to enhance their API building proficiency, especially beginners seeking practical and step-by-step guidance. Perfect for learners aiming to launch a career in backend development, build solid API fundamentals, or advance their technical portfolio with Django REST Framework.

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.

Watch now

Unlock full access

More than 5,000 organizations count on O’Reilly

AirBnbBlueOriginElectronic ArtsHomeDepotNasdaqRakutenTata Consultancy Services

QuotationMarkO’Reilly covers everything we've got, with content to help us build a world-class technology community, upgrade the capabilities and competencies of our teams, and improve overall team performance as well as their engagement.
Julian F.
Head of Cybersecurity
QuotationMarkI wanted to learn C and C++, but it didn't click for me until I picked up an O'Reilly book. When I went on the O’Reilly platform, I was astonished to find all the books there, plus live events and sandboxes so you could play around with the technology.
Addison B.
Field Engineer
QuotationMarkI’ve been on the O’Reilly platform for more than eight years. I use a couple of learning platforms, but I'm on O'Reilly more than anybody else. When you're there, you start learning. I'm never disappointed.
Amir M.
Data Platform Tech Lead
QuotationMarkI'm always learning. So when I got on to O'Reilly, I was like a kid in a candy store. There are playlists. There are answers. There's on-demand training. It's worth its weight in gold, in terms of what it allows me to do.
Mark W.
Embedded Software Engineer

You might also like

Creating APIs with Python - Django REST Framework

Creating APIs with Python - Django REST Framework

Nick Walter

Publisher Resources

ISBN: 9781801819022